I was in for an overnight stay on Stannon ward on level 11 after a spinal op. I was in for the op Monday morning and left around 1pm Tuesday. They were putting up Christmas decorations as I arrived on the ward from recovery. That was a nice site to see and put me at ease. The staff on the ward are brilliant as are the medical team that dealt with my op. Every last one of them gives at least 110% at all times. The ward was spotlessly clean at all times with any incidents responded to immediately. I saw the cleaning being done and that too was very thorough. Apart from the female staff member from pharmacy who actually confiscated my BP tablets (prescribed by my GP...) because they were different to what she thought I was taking. I hadn't informed them of any different ones at any stage so she just made no sense. I got them back from a nurse later when she'd gone. But every other member of staff I had the pleasure of dealing with was excellent. Medical staff, care team afterwards, physio, catering, cleaning. All first class.
